A Carroll County Senator's request for an Emergency Declaration has been denied.
In Carroll County, State Senator Brian King’s emergency declaration request has been denied by Governor Sarah Huckabee Sanders office.
King asked the governor’s office to declare an emergency on Friday following the closure of the company Cooks Venture.
KARK News reports that King hoped the state would step in to offer financial support for chicken growers in northern Arkansas who raised over 1 million chickens under contract with the company but will now receive no compensation. Secretary of Agriculture Wes Ward wrote, “The state of Arkansas cannot assume responsibility for a company simply because that company has encountered financial distress.”
